Strictly Come Dancing 2021 winners Rose Ayling-Ellis and Giovanni Pernice have been showered with love after their reunion performance.

The duo were back in the ballroom for the first time since the Strictly arena tour this past winter for the BBC's fundraising telethon Comic Relief on Friday night (March 18).

To help raise money for those most vulnerable in the UK and beyond (including Ukraine), the duo recreated their waltz to Ellie Goulding's 'How Long Will I Love You?' from the Strictly semi-final.

Sir Lenny Henry also got the chance to speak with Rose and Gio after their performance, where the dancers shared how much it meant to be back together.

"It's really nice to dance together again," Rose told Lenny. "We went through a really special journey. Every time we pair up, it brings back happy memories. We really enjoy dancing together."

Giovanni also reiterated his hopes that people with physical differences continue to feel inspired by the journey Rose took through Strictly last year.

"As Rose showed this year, it doesn't have to stop anybody," he pointed out. "If you really want to follow your dream, if you really love dancing, you just have to go and do it."

Red Nose Day viewers were blown away by the performance, with many Strictly fans calling it "beautiful". One viewer described Rose and Giovanni as "the best couple Strictly ever had".

"Awwww Giovanni and Rose are incredible! Rose is definitely an inspiring individual! Anything can happen," another added.

One fan wrote: "Giovanni and Rose you still reduce me to tears when you dance together."
